Request for Proposals For Consultation regarding Upgrades to the City-owned Ice Plant

REQUEST FOR PROPOSALS
By the City of Homer, Alaska
For Consultation regarding Upgrades to the City-owned Ice Plant

The City of Homer is requesting proposals from qualified firms for the purpose of a consultation contract, which at point of contract award will include performing a site visit to Homer’s Ice Plant to evaluate our options and provide a list of recommendations for optimizing and/or upgrading our ice plant and cold storage facility.

Earthquake Preparedness

What To Do During An Earthquake

  • If you are indoors, drop, cover, and hold on. Take cover under a desk or table and hold onto it until the shaking stops. Avoid glass that might shatter and heavy objects that might fall on you. If you can’t get under a table or desk, crouch against a sturdy wall in a place where nothing heavy is above you and no windows are nearby.
     
  • If you are in a crowded area, stay calm and take cover where you are. Encourage others to do the same.

Be Prepared to "Grab & Go" During an Evacuation

In the event of an earthquake, tsunami or fire, you may have to quickly evacuate your home or workplace with little or no warning.  Make a "Grab & Go Bag" of essentials to grab on your way out.  A "Grab & Go Bag" is a packed case that will help keep you safe and comfortable in the coming hours and days.
